Blueberry Ginger Fizz

A refreshing summer drink made with fresh blueberries, ginger, and lemon-lime soda. Ingredients

1 cup cup
Fresh blueberries
80 Calories
2 cups cup
Ginger ale
160 Calories
1 cup cup
Lemon-lime soda
0 Calories
a few sprigs sprig
Fresh mint leaves
0 Calories
a few cubes cube
Ice cubes
0 Calories
a few slices slice
Lemon slices
0 Calories
1-inch piece piece
Fresh ginger
10 Calories

Step-by-Step Instructions

1
Rinse the fresh blueberries and pick out any stems or debris.
2
In a blender or food processor, puree the blueberries until smooth.
3
Strain the blueberry puree through a fine-mesh sieve into a large pitcher or jug.
4
Add the ginger ale and lemon-lime soda to the pitcher and stir to combine.
5
Add a few slices of lemon and a few sprigs of fresh mint to the pitcher for garnish.
6
Fill glasses with ice and pour the Blueberry Ginger Fizz over the ice.
